Compaction stalls in the Brindlemux queue during CI stem from segment files held open by the lagging consumer fixture; the compactor correctly refuses to delete them. The fix closes the fixture before triggering compaction, and the test now asserts segment count post-run. Please verify against the exact build recorded below.

build token for kagaf-hahof: htk14_9d3d4d26d7d8de

### Runbook — Account Recovery (Stormcall Fan-out)

New folks: the Stormcall alert fan-out runs under a service account that occasionally gets locked after credential rotation. When alerts stop fanning out to regional queues, check the account status first, not the queues. If locked, use the recovery console on the bastion host and select the fan-out service account. The console accepts one attempt and asks for the passphrase below.

vault phrase of bagaf-kajeg = jorath-feniel-briir-siliel-ralix

# Tovari CSV Import Wizard — environment config
# On-call notes: the wizard stages uploads in the scratch bucket, validates
# headers against the tenant schema, then commits rows in batches of 500.
# If imports stall, check the staging queue depth before restarting anything;
# a restart mid-batch will re-enqueue the whole file. Row-level errors land
# in the rejects table and are safe to replay. The wizard signs each commit
# request to the ingest service, and that signing credential is set on the next line:

secret setting of yafof-tawep: RELAY_SECRET8=8abb5772

## Runbook: Gridlock Crossword Generator — Release Steps

1. Tag the release branch; CI builds the puzzle-pack and binary artifacts.
2. Run dictionary-integrity check; abort on any wordlist drift.
3. Smoke-test grid generation on the staging pool (min 50 puzzles, no unsolvable grids).
4. Sign artifacts. Promotion gate rejects anything unsigned.
5. Push to the distribution bucket; verify checksums post-upload.
6. Announce in the release channel.

Notes: rotation last done in March. Sign using the key below.

signing key of bagap-yawep = bky13_TbfT6ZMUoGJo2